Oakland Police Investigation Leads to Arrests in Livermore

Livermore police assist Oakland officers in ongoing investigation.

Several have been arrested by Oakland Police, who on Thursday canvassed the north Livermore area.

Officials are not providing any details of the arrests and are saying the case is part of an ongoing investigation.

"We have arrested a couple suspects for possession of firearms and narcotics," said Lt. Blair Alexander of the Oakland Police Department.

Captain Steve Gallagher would not provide further details and said local officers assisted Oakland Police in the investigation.

Alexander said the people who were arrested were not Livermore residents.

As of 2:30 p.m., a woman was in custody of the California Highway Patrol. In addition, a man and teen boy also appeared to be in custody. They were arrested at a parking lot betwen the shopping center and department store on Las Positas Road, Alexander said.

Police were searching cars and were seen taking a woman and children from a car, a witness said on the Livermore Patch Facebook page. A SWAT unit and helicopter were also seen in the area. It appeared that a silver Lexus and black Toyota were involved.

A police command center was set this morning at the back parking lot of the on North Livermore Avenue, just across the Roselawn Cemetery.
